Development and evaluation of bio-nanoparticles as novel drug carriers for the delivery of Donepezil
The purpose of the present study was to formulate and evaluate donepezil loaded bio-nanoparticles for effective treatment of Alzheimer’s disease. For the preparation of bio-nanoparticles biomaterial was isolated from fruits of Carica papaya by an economic method. Papaya (Carica papaya) is an economically important fruit crop that mostly planted in tropical and subtropical regions. Major diseases of papaya, such as the papaya dieback disease (PDD), ringspot virus (PRSV) disease, sticky (PSD), have caused large yield economic losses papaya-producing countries worldwide. In vitro efficacy of five indigenous plants namely Bishkatali (Polygonum hydropiper), Neem (Azadirachta indica), Papaya (Carica papaya), Korolla (Momordica charantia) and Mahogany (Swietenia macrophylla) were studied against the development of Ascaridia galli eggs from July 2007 to May 2008.
